Raffaello Sanzio da Urbino (1483-1520)
• Was an Italian painter and architect of the High Renaissance.
• Raphael was one of the finest draftsmen in the history of Western art, and used drawings extensively to plan his compositions.
• He was one of the last artists to use metalpoint (literally a sharp pointed piece of silver or another metal) extensively, although he also made superb use of the freer medium of red or black chalk.
• In his final years he was one of the first artists to use female models for preparatory drawings—male pupils ("garzoni") were normally used for studies of both sexes.
